Changes in PCSK 9 and apolipoprotein B100 in Niemann-Pick disease after enzyme replacement therapy with olipudase alfa.

Bethanie GarsideJan Hoong HoSee KwokYifen LiuShaishav DhageRachelle DonnZohaib IqbalSimon A JonesHandrean Soran
Published in: Orphanet journal of rare diseases (2021)
This study demonstrated that patients with NPD-B had a proatherogenic lipid profile and higher circulating TNF-α compared to reference group. There was an improvement in dyslipidaemia after olipudase alfa. It was possible that reductions in LDL-C and apoB100 were driven by reductions in TNF-α and PCSK9 following ERT.
